Mr. Kennedy introduced the following bill; which was read twice and referred to the Committee on Banking, Housing, and Urban Affairs

A BILL

To prohibit the Export-Import Bank of the United States from providing financing to persons with seriously delinquent tax debt.

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led,

SECTION 1. Prohibition on financing by Export-Import Bank of the United States for persons with seriously delinquent tax debt.
